Roof pitch refers to the vertical rise divided by the horizontal span, or what is commonly known as the slope of the roof. Life expectancy of 25 years. … Web17 mei 2024 · The lower the roof pitch, the more difficult it becomes to construct an effective eaves system, particularly where roofspace ventilation is required. Remember that the eaves course tiles carry all the rainwater that the roof face has collected and must shed that water safely into the gutter. folding recumbent tadpole trikes
